ORTHOPTERA, proper noun. A taxonomic order within the subdivision Polyneoptera — various insects including crickets, grasshoppers, wetas, katydids, etc... It formerly included many other groups such as cockroaches, stick insects, mantids and earwigs, which are now classified in other orders
ORTHOPTERA, noun. Any of very many four-winged insects, of the order Orthoptera, such as grasshoppers, crickets and locusts
